Pokemon Legends Arceus Fan Makes Incredible Poke Ball Art: Pokemon Legends: Arceus was released just a few weeks back, and in the time since, many players from the franchise have begun playing for the title. It set in the old Hisui region The latest game in the series design to shake things up by focusing on the past.
In the end, many objects given a fresh look to reflect the period. During the tournament, the most notable redesigns one design for The Poke Ball.
Since the start of the series, Pokemon Trainers have using Poke Balls to capture Pokemon. They are tiny round containers with an upper red half and a white lower portion. As the name implies. In Pokemon Legends: Arceus, the balls give a new look with an edgier look.
Instead of a glossy metallic surface, the balls were now brown since certain parts appear to make from wood. A gamer recently inspire to capture this unique but old-fashioned design into an original work of artwork.
In an article on Reddit, one of the users named TiphCreations posted an image of a work of art they created with Photoshop. It was not a standard image. The artist decided to make a fanart inspired by a Poke Ball.
Pokemon Legends Arceus Fan Makes Incredible Poke Ball Art
Additionally, the artwork included the brand new design seen in the newly launched Pokemon Legends: Arceus. The photo shows a rustic Poke Ball sitting in the middle of a grassy area. The image capture at night, which allowed smoke and sparks to observe coming from the object, creating the soft light to project onto grass blades surrounding it.
After posting this stunning Poke Ball art on Reddit and other sites, many from the Pokemoncommunity were taken aback. With over 500 likes within a matter of days, many liked the look created for the Poke Ball based on Pokemon Legends: Arceus.
Some users on Reddit, like skylarvapes, mentioned how realistic the particle effects such as smoke and sparks make the picture more amazing. Additionally, many people commented that they would like to make this fanart their next wallpaper. “Oh, man, I’d like to have this as my wallpaper for my phone,” SuperFlashSteel said.
